What happens to a nail that is black from beng smashed in a door jamb?

Depends on the degree of injury. The nail might stay on, and the bruise beneath the nail might simply fade. The nail might fall off and eventually be replaced with a new nail just like the old one. Or the new nail might come out thick and uneven. It might stay like that, or it might turn back to normal ever so slowly.

What is in nail polish that makes it last longer?

Most polishes use acrylic resins, like the ones found in the enamel paint that you see on refrigerators and other appliances. But it is not baked on, so it is removable with polish remover (it dissolves in acetone). And it is not as tough, so it may chip or crack. The nail itself has a durable top layer that resists breaking but can be softened and damaged by chemicals.
